About the project
Patients with advanced chronic liver disease (ACLD) frequently develop life-threatening bacterial infections despite exhibiting profound systemic inflammation. Understanding why immune cells progressively lose their host defence function during disease progression remains one of the major unanswered questions in hepatology. We are seeking a highly motivated PhD candidate to join a newly established research programme investigating human immunometabolism within the DFG-funded Collaborative Research Centre (CRC) 1382 Gut–Liver Axis. The project combines clinical research with mechanistic immunology to understand how immunometabolic programmes regulate immune cell function during progression from compensated cirrhosis to acute-on-chronic liver failure (ACLF). Using unique longitudinal patient cohorts, we aim to identify the metabolic pathways driving immune dysfunction and determine whether these pathways can be therapeutically restored. Ultimately, this work seeks to establish immunometabolism as a novel therapeutic target in advanced liver disease.

Your research
The project combines patient-oriented translational research with state-of-the-art immunology and metabolic profiling. During your PhD, you will investigate how immune cell metabolism changes across different stages of liver disease and how gut-derived inflammatory signals contribute to immune dysfunction.

You will receive extensive training in cutting-edge technologies, including:

  • High-dimensional multicolour flow cytometry
  • Single-cell metabolic profiling (SCENITH)
  • Mitochondrial functional assays (i.a. Seahorse)
  • Functional T-cell and monocyte assays
  • Multiplex cytokine profiling (Luminex)
  • Targeted metabolomics
  • Single-cell RNAseq
  • Bioinformatic analysis of high-dimensional datasets
